Precautions When Using More Than One SERVOPACK

This section shows an example of the wiring when more than one SERVOPACK is
used and the precautions.

• Wiring Example (Analog model)

The alarm output (ALM) terminals in each SERVOPACK individually operate differ-
ent alarm detection relays: 1Ry, 2Ry, and 3Ry respectively.

When the alarm occurs, the ALM output signal transistor is turned OFF.

In DC power input

Σ

-V Series SERVOPACKs, all ground terminals

for the four sequence output signals are named COM_SG. There-
fore, do not connect the ALM output signal of multiple SERVO-
PACKs in series.
